About

Rebecca Batorsky is a scholar working on Molecular Biology, Immunology and Virology. According to data from OpenAlex, Rebecca Batorsky has authored 22 papers receiving a total of 248 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Molecular Biology, 8 papers in Immunology and 6 papers in Virology. Recurrent topics in Rebecca Batorsky's work include HIV Research and Treatment (6 papers), Neuroinflammation and Neurodegeneration Mechanisms (5 papers) and T-cell and B-cell Immunology (4 papers). Rebecca Batorsky is often cited by papers focused on HIV Research and Treatment (6 papers), Neuroinflammation and Neurodegeneration Mechanisms (5 papers) and T-cell and B-cell Immunology (4 papers). Rebecca Batorsky collaborates with scholars based in United States, United Kingdom and Czechia. Rebecca Batorsky's co-authors include Igor M. Rouzine, John M. Coffin, Frank Maldarelli, Mary F. Kearney, Sarah Palmer, Xudong Li, Alexander Poltorak, Amanda J. Martinot, David Jetton and Edouard Vannier and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Nucleic Acids Research and Scientific Reports.
